
上QQ阅读APP看书,第一时间看更新
1.7 主配置文件简介
主配置文件mybatis-config.xml用来配置系统运行环境,包含事务管理方式、数据库连接类型与信息、指定映射文件等。除了上面第一个项目用到的一些标签之外,还有其他一些标签(标签也可称为节点或元素),MyBatis主配置文件的所有主要标签如图1.6所示。
<configuration>下的所有子标签并不是都必须配置,但若需要配置时,必须按图1.6所示的先后顺序来配置,否则MyBatis会报错。
<properties>标签的作用是将内部的配置转化为外部的配置,从而能够动态地替换内部定义的属性。例如,数据库的连接信息,原来是在内部配置,通过<properties>属性,让系统读取外部的属性文件,第1.5节就是<properties>的典型应用案例。

图1.6 主配置文件子标签